Dream meaning: Water
Water represents the state of your emotions and subconscious mind. Calm, clear water suggests peace, while turbulent or muddy water indicates emotional distress.
📜 Classical Sources
Ancient dream guides placed immense weight on the quality of the water. Drinking clear, cool water from a spring was seen as an omen of excellent health, purity, and spiritual favor from the gods. Conversely, dreaming of muddy, stagnant, or boiling water was a warning of physical illness, severe deception, and upcoming tribulations.
⚡ Folklore & Omens
In folklore, large bodies of water represent the unpredictable journey of life. Crossing a calm stream or swimming in clear water is a positive omen of overcoming obstacles and achieving prosperity. However, falling into deep water, drowning, or being swept away by a flood is a warning of being overwhelmed by emotional conflicts, debt, or severe misfortune.
🔮 Symbolism
Water is the universal symbol of the unconscious mind, the emotional self, and the flow of life. It represents cleansing, renewal, fertility, and spiritual purification. The state of the water in your dream directly mirrors your current emotional state—still water indicates inner peace, while raging seas signify turmoil and unresolved anxiety.
🧠 Psychology
In Carl Jung's analytical psychology, water is the primary symbol of the subconscious, especially the deep, mysterious waters of the collective unconscious. Sigmund Freud associated water dreams with birth, maternal safety, and prenatal security. Modern therapists view turbulent water as a clear sign that you are grappling with overwhelming emotions in waking life.
